Serie A: Juventus 3-3 Sampdoria

Juventus scored three times, but was unable to record their first win of the season as they twice relinquished the lead in an enthralling 3-3 draw against Sampdoria.

Sampdoria took the lead in th 36th minute through Nicola Pozzi but Juve got back on terms through Claudio Marchisio two minutes before the break.

Simone Pepe gave Juventus the lead by stabbing the ball home following a goalmouth scramble, but Antonio Cassano then linked up with Angelo Palombo to equalise in the 64th minute.

Fabio Quagliarella restored Juve's lead three minutes later only for Pozzi to score his second of the match and give Sampdoria a share of the points.
